Dumpster Dimension Choices



For selecting the appropriate dumpster dimension, it's vital to have a good understanding of the available choices. Dumpster dimensions commonly vary from 10 to 40 cubic lawns, with variations in between.

A 10-yard dumpster is suitable for small jobs like a garage cleanout or a little improvement. If you're taking on a medium-sized job such as a cooking area remodel or a basement cleanout, a 20-yard dumpster might be the ideal option.

For larger jobs like a whole-house remodelling or industrial building and construction, a 30 or 40-yard dumpster could be better to accommodate the quantity of waste created.

When choosing a dumpster dimension, consider the amount and kind of particles you anticipate to dispose of. It's much better to choose a slightly larger size if you're unclear to stop overfilling. Keep in mind, it's more cost-effective to lease a dumpster that fits your requirements as opposed to having to order an additional one.

Matching Dimension to Job



Efficiently matching the dumpster size to your task is essential for reliable waste administration. To identify you could try these out , consider the range and nature of your project.

For small household cleanouts or improvements, a 10-yard dumpster might be sufficient. These are commonly 12 feet long and can hold around 4 pickup truck lots of waste.

For larger projects like redesigning numerous spaces or clearing out a big estate, a 20-yard dumpster might be more suitable. These are around 22 feet long and can hold about 8 pickup loads.

If you're tackling a significant building and construction project or business improvement, a 30-yard dumpster could be the very best fit. These dumpsters have to do with 22 feet long and can suit regarding 12 pickup truck lots of particles.



Matching the dumpster dimension to your task ensures you have adequate room for all waste products without overpaying for extra capacity.
